Output f8817499cfe51d763f856758ae197406e20c48c36ea8934c5770976b295b000a:0

value
43435920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cb7964ca1f9125a0eac13b12d4362aae1f33a44 OP_EQUALVERIFY OP_CHECKSIG
address
1FHeLnKUH9ozswd48NuqpsmVTZAs34bG4a
transaction
f8817499cfe51d763f856758ae197406e20c48c36ea8934c5770976b295b000a
confirmations
427644
spent
true